     XListFonts(3X11)    X Version 11 (Release 5)     XListFonts(3X11)



     NAME
          XListFonts, XFreeFontNames, XListFontsWithInfo,
          XFreeFontInfo - obtain or free font names and information

     SYNTAX
          char **XListFonts(display, pattern, maxnames,
          actual_count_return)
                Display *display;
                char *pattern;
                int maxnames;
                int *actual_count_return;

          XFreeFontNames(list)
                char *list[];

          char **XListFontsWithInfo(display, pattern, maxnames,
          count_return, info_return)
                Display *display;
                char *pattern;
                int maxnames;
                int *count_return;
                XFontStruct **info_return;

          XFreeFontInfo(names, free_info, actual_count)
                char **names;
                XFontStruct *free_info;
                int actual_count;

     ARGUMENTS
          actual_count
                    Specifies the actual number of matched font names
                    returned by XListFontsWithInfo.

          actual_count_return
                    Returns the actual number of font names.

          count_return
                    Returns the actual number of matched font names.

          display   Specifies the connection to the X server.

          info_return
                    Returns the font information.

          free_info Specifies the font information returned by
                    XListFontsWithInfo.

          list      Specifies the array of strings you want to free.

          maxnames  Specifies the maximum number of names to be
                    returned.

          names     Specifies the list of font names returned by
                    XListFontsWithInfo.

          pattern   Specifies the null-terminated pattern string that
                    can contain wildcard characters.

     DESCRIPTION
          The XListFonts function returns an array of available font
          names (as controlled by the font search path; see
          XSetFontPath) that match the string you passed to the
          pattern argument.  The pattern string can contain any
          characters, but each asterisk (*) is a wildcard for any
          number of characters, and each question mark (?) is a
          wildcard for a single character.  If the pattern string is
          not in the Host Portable Character Encoding the result is
          implementation dependent.  Use of uppercase or lowercase
          does not matter.  Each returned string is null-terminated.
          If the data returned by the server is in the Latin Portable
          Character Encoding, then the returned strings are in the
          Host Portable Character Encoding.  Otherwise, the result is
          implementation dependent.  If there are no matching font
          names, XListFonts returns NULL.  The client should call
          XFreeFontNames when finished with the result to free the
          memory.

          The XFreeFontNames function frees the array and strings
          returned by XListFonts or XListFontsWithInfo.

          The XListFontsWithInfo function returns a list of font names
          that match the specified pattern and their associated font
          information.  The list of names is limited to size specified
          by maxnames.  The information returned for each font is
          identical to what XLoadQueryFont would return except that
          the per-character metrics are not returned.  The pattern
          string can contain any characters, but each asterisk (*) is
          a wildcard for any number of characters, and each question
          mark (?) is a wildcard for a single character.  If the
          pattern string is not in the Host Portable Character
          Encoding the result is implementation dependent.  Use of
          uppercase or lowercase does not matter.  Each returned
          string is null-terminated.  If the data returned by the
          server is in the Latin Portable Character Encoding, then the
          returned strings are in the Host Portable Character
          Encoding.  Otherwise, the result is implementation
          dependent.  If there are no matching font names,
          XListFontsWithInfo returns NULL.

          To free only the allocated name array, the client should
          call XFreeFontNames.  To free both the name array and the
          font information array, or to free just the font information
          array, the client should call XFreeFontInfo.

          The XFreeFontInfo function frees the the font information
          array.  To free an XFontStruct structure without closing the
          font, call XFreeFontInfo with the names argument specified
          as NULL.
